It’s the final League Express of 2017!

Thanks to all our readers for their support throughout this year, and to round the year off, we’ve a bumper issue which looks both backwards, and forwards.

Here’s what we’ve got in this week’s paper – which you can have delivered to your smart device on Sunday night by simply clicking here:

We sit down for an exclusive Q&A interview with RFL boss Nigel Wood – where he discusses everything from England’s game in Denver, Wayne Bennett’s future as coach, the league structure, New York, Sky’s TV deal and much more..
..while the main man also gives us an insight into his own future in the sport in an extended interview you cannot miss.
We speak to RFL Rugby Director Kevin Sinfield about the possibility of that Denver game against New Zealand – while he also gives us an update on Bennett, and when his future will be decided.
Our editor Martyn Sadler names his League Express Man of the Year.
What’s the latest with the takeover at Salford Red Devils? We’ve got an update for you, Red Devils fans.
There’s news of a new signing on the way at Super League side Wakefield Trinity..
..while we’ve also got something of interest for Castleford fans, relating to a player who is joining on trial.
There’s an early Christmas present for Huddersfield fans as we reveal which big name is in advanced talks to extend his stay at the club.
Which high-profile Super League player are Catalans Dragons interested in? We’ll tell you.
There’s an interview with the returning Dan Sarginson, who admits he’s out to prove his doubters wrong.
We reveal which overseas player Hull KR are considering moving on from the club.
There’s news of a new recruit at Leigh Centurions as their squad for 2018 nears completion.
All that plus the latest news from every club in the Championship and League 1, all the latest amateur news and the usual hard-hitting columns.

Every Monday, League Express brings you the best news, match reports and pictures from around the world of Rugby League including comprehensive coverage of every game in the Betfred Super League, Championship and League 1, plus the Australian NRL.

We also bring you the latest news from your local club and the international game, plus in-depth coverage of the grassroots game.

Columnists include editor Martyn Sadler, former Great Britain star and Golden Boot winner Garry Schofield, and Daily Mirror Rugby League correspondent Gareth Walker’s regular Championship View. Our lively Mailbag contains a wide selection of views from readers on all aspects of the game, while League Talk focuses on the lighter side of Rugby League as well as carrying details of the latest club events and fundraisers taking place. It’s an unbeatable package for any Rugby League supporter.
